From cd5aacd462e9dec11b774f44711a0c875bc2cfbe Mon Sep 17 00:00:00 2001 From: Martin Schwidefsky Date: Wed, 7 May 2008 09:22:56 +0200 Subject: [PATCH] --- yaml --- r: 96147 b: refs/heads/master c: c6ca1850e78d60c299ceb4c240a04af9e2384f70 h: refs/heads/master i: 96145: 342e3f49cbca877cefdf8fd0075e0be729649b19 96143: 67ddf56a4b9745f23327268c24b24edfd03ad5f3 v: v3 --- [refs] | 2 +- trunk/drivers/s390/s390mach.c | 3 ++- 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/[refs] b/[refs] index 510de722da97..ef4ee80e4146 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: 5b8909871b80a6cc2bd21aa5262c1424e3d26339 +refs/heads/master: c6ca1850e78d60c299ceb4c240a04af9e2384f70 diff --git a/trunk/drivers/s390/s390mach.c b/trunk/drivers/s390/s390mach.c index 4d4b54277c43..5080f343ad74 100644 --- a/trunk/drivers/s390/s390mach.c +++ b/trunk/drivers/s390/s390mach.c @@ -48,10 +48,11 @@ s390_collect_crw_info(void *param) int ccode; struct semaphore *sem; unsigned int chain; + int ignore; sem = (struct semaphore *)param; repeat: - down_interruptible(sem); + ignore = down_interruptible(sem); chain = 0; while (1) { if (unlikely(chain > 1)) {